Join us for the launch of best-selling author Lisa Scottoline’s new legal thriller, Dirty Blonde! Ever since Lisa Scottoline burst onto the scene with Everywhere That Mary Went, the legal thriller has never been the same. A former trial lawyer and Edgar Award winner, Scottoline writes sexy, funny, sharp and compulsively readable books that draw on her experience in the courtroom as well as her state and federal judicial clerkships. In Dirty Blonde, Scottoline puts federal Judge Cate Fante in the middle of a double murder that jeopardizes her personal life and career and forces her to... you’ll just have to read the book!
